I have created a new version:
http://www.spicenitz.org/fedora/mlton-20051202-3.src.rpm
http://www.spicenitz.org/fedora/mlton.spec

Changes:
Create PDF documentation for mlyacc and mllex, by patching the 
makefile to use pdflatex.
Move ckit-lib/doc and smlnj-lib/Doc to %{_docdir}.
Remove regression files from ckit.

I did not move the various documentation files sprinkled about 
lib/sml/* (like README, etc) because the libraries in there are
basically MLton-modified third-party packages, and the files
often refer to the actual directory it's in (by saying things
like "the files in this directory are ..."). I could move the
files, but I'm not sure people would expect that.

Also, I do have a PPC machine here, and have been testing all
my work with it.
